I was lured into buying the foam cannon by watching the videos on youtube. It really does make the whole washing experience much more fun and easy.


I mixed 3 oz of DP auto shampoo with water, then shook the bottle up and let it do its thing. Overall, I was very impressed with the result. It covered the car quickly and did a good job of dwelling on the surface.

Just cause I have never seen the whole process of washing a car with the foam cannon, after you foam it down do you then go into a normal 2 bucket wash?

Yes, I let the foam sit for a few minutes, and then go into my regular wash methods.

It works wonders on a prepped car with only dust on it since it pretty much slides all the dust off. I'll foam it, let it sit for a few, then just use the sheeting method, dry with a waffle weave, and I'm done.

@maximus: i did the 2b wash method after foaming the whole car. but easier on the grubbing since all the dirt and grimes mostly washed away.

@bmwgeek: the bottle can hold 1 liter of shampoo, i diluted 1:3 megs deep crystal with water. it can be used up to 2 more times full body washing.

the shampoo actually broke down the dirt and grimes faster than standard method. and you don't have to take the nozzle on and off your pressure washer, just take off the bottle and spray away the foam with water.

i like this method coz it lessen the swirl mark risk.
